THE REFUGEES LAMENT
This Lament was written after David had watched a documentary on the
displacement of ordinary people and families during the recent Balkan conflict. He, like most of us,
was genuinely moved by the plight of these poor people as they fled their homes and villages in fear
with their meagre possessions tied up in pitiful bundles on hand carts. The Lament was composed to represent the sadness he felt for those millions
of displaced refugees past and present and the stark melody for solo cello invokes the tragedy of
their plight and portrays mans inhumanity to man.
